Bart Collet
I'm a healthcare innovation catalyst based in Antwerp, Belgium. For over 30 years, I've been transforming complex healthcare challenges into scalable solutions — blending healthcare insight, cross-industry creativity, and relentless execution.
For a quarter of a century, I managed Huis Vandecruys, a 72-resident elderly care facility with 50 staff members, pioneering operational excellence and compassionate care delivery. That frontline experience gives me unique credibility with both clinicians and C-suite executives.
As a digital builder, I created JPLAN (2003) — a web-based healthcare staff scheduling tool — and CALBLOX (2013), a tablet-optimised task management platform for healthcare workers. I've orchestrated five international digital health events, conducted four public hackathons launching seven successful companies, and led VR4Rehab's international virtual hackathon with 15 teams in just 10 days.
Currently, I'm focused on automation strategies, new business models and the longevity economy — the companies, conferences, and communities shaping the future of healthspan. I run the Longevity Events Calendar, a curated database of 300+ longevity conferences worldwide.

Advisory & Speaking
I serve on advisory boards including SXSW, ICT&Health, eHealth Hub, and AI4Health, providing foresight on digital health trends and emerging opportunities. Past consulting clients include the Flemish government (IPCEI funding), McKesson (pharmacy strategy), Coca-Cola (health and nutrition innovation), UCB Pharma (Hack Epilepsy — eyeforpharma Barcelona Awards 2016), and GitLab (inaugural Pitch Innovation Competition).
